The ingredients needed to make Mandazi:
  1. Get 500 g all purpose flour
  2. Make ready 150 g sugar
  3. Prepare 3 eggs
  4. Take 4 tbsp cinamon
  5. Get 1 tsp baking powder
  6. Take 250 ml milk
  7. Make ready 100 g blueband
  8. Make ready Enough oil for deep frying

Mandazi (Swahili: Mandazi, Maandazi ), is a form of fried bread that originated on the Swahili Coast. See recipes for Mandazi, Soft Mandazi too. Mandazi are subtly sweet, making them more versatile than sugary, Western-style doughnuts. They're often used to sop up savory curries, such as pigeon peas cooked in coconut milk.

Instructions to make Mandazi:
  1. Put flour in a bowl, mix it with baking powder and sieve.
  2. Add sugar, melt the blue band in a microwave and add. Add in the flour, rub it in to form breadcrumbs
  3. Break eggs into a bowl and whisk them, then add to the flour gently knead the flour using warm milk and cinnamon powder.
  4. Knead the flour until it is smooth/soft and does not stick in your hands. or the bowl you are kneading from.
  5. Let the dough rest for best results.-15 mins. Then dust your working surface and out the dough into an inch thickness.
  6. Cut into desired shapes and deep fry the mandazi in your already hot oil.until golden brown.
  7. Dry in a paper towel then serve.
